A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, especially a dish washer port, connects the dish washer to a water resource. A plumber can guarantee that the line is suitable with both your dishwashing machine and also water resource if you get a new supply line. If you determine to make use of an existing supply line, a specialist plumber can inspect it to guarantee that it remains in good condition and also does not have any type of leakages.

Mounting a Dishwasher Calls For a Range of Equipments


If you do not have a selection of devices on hand, you may need to make a trip to copyright's or Residence Depot. To set up a dishwashing machine, you require the adhering to dev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ws. You will also require cleansing supplies such as a shallow container and sponge. The cost to buy them can include up swiftly if you do not have any of these items.

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Correctly Can Lead to a Mountain of Problems


Not only can setting up a dishwasher correctly void your guarantee, yet it can also develop a mess. If you do not mount the supply line appropriately, you can deal with leaks-- or even worse, a flood. You could addit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well quickly via your pipes and causes loud drinking noises. If you inaccurately mount your dish washer to the garbage disposal, you may notice poignant scents or have deposit on your recipes.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
